summaryrefslogtreecommitdiffstats
path: root/system/database/drivers/oci8
AgeCommit message (Collapse)AuthorFilesLines
2012-03-13Swtich _bind_params() from private to protectedAndrey Andreev1-1/+1
2012-03-13Merge upstream branchAndrey Andreev4-4/+4
2012-03-09Merge branch 'develop' of github.com:EllisLab/CodeIgniter into developPhil Sturgeon2-7/+4
2012-03-09Bumped CodeIgniter's PHP requirement to 5.2.4.Phil Sturgeon4-4/+4
Yes I know PHP 5.4 just came out, and yes I know PHP 5.3 has lovely features, but there are plenty of corporate systems running on CodeIgniter and PHP 5.3 still is not widely supported enough. CodeIgniter is great for distributed applications, and this is the highest we can reasonably go without breaking support. PHP 5.3 will most likely happen in another year or so. Fingers crossed on that one anyway...
2012-03-09Merge upstream branchAndrey Andreev1-2/+1
2012-03-06Resolve _protect_identifiers()/protect_identifiers() usage issuesAndrey Andreev2-7/+4
2012-03-05Rename property _commit to commit_mode and merge upstream changesAndrey Andreev2-40/+28
2012-03-05Removed oci8-specific stuff from DB_driver.php and added a constructor to ↵Andrey Andreev1-3/+12
DB_result to handle initialization
2012-03-03Improve DB version() implementation and add pg_version() supportAndrey Andreev1-5/+6
2012-03-02Replaced DB methods _error_message() and _error_number() with error() (issue ↵Andrey Andreev1-28/+7
#1097)
2012-03-02Merge upstream branchAndrey Andreev1-6/+6
2012-03-02Fix a bug in Oracle's DB forge _create_table() method (AUTO_INCREMENT is not ↵Andrey Andreev1-47/+17
supported)
2012-03-01Merge upstream branchAndrey Andreev1-14/+18
2012-03-01Fix issue #413 (Oracle _error_message(), _error_number())Andrey Andreev1-8/+30
2012-03-01Merge upstream branchAndrey Andreev1-15/+0
2012-03-01Merge upstream changesAndrey Andreev1-8/+6
2012-03-01Merge upstream branchAndrey Andreev1-1/+1
2012-03-01Fix an Oracle escape_str() bug (#68, #414)Andrey Andreev1-8/+6
2012-02-28Fix escape_like_str()Andrey Andreev1-2/+2
2012-02-27Fixed a db_set_charset() bugAndrey Andreev1-16/+0
2012-02-13Fix Easy Connect string regexp and give TNS priority over itAndrey Andreev1-2/+2
2012-02-13Add DSN string supportAndrey Andreev1-2/+85
2012-02-12Replace a few spaces with a tabAndrey Andreev1-1/+1
2012-02-12Improve custom_result_object() methodAndrey Andreev1-6/+5
2012-01-26Replace array_key_exists() with isset() and ! empty()Andrey Andreev2-5/+5
2012-01-26DB forge escaping relatedAndrey Andreev2-9/+9
2012-01-24Revert a space in the license agreement :)Andrey Andreev4-4/+4
2012-01-20Replaced AND with &&Andrey Andreev2-2/+1
2012-01-19Some more cleaningAndrey Andreev2-16/+4
2012-01-16Removed some unneeded code and fixed a possible bugAndrey Andreev1-67/+10
2012-01-16Additional clean-upAndrey Andreev4-226/+123
2012-01-05Really fix error handling :)Andrey Andreev1-1/+1
2012-01-05Fix issue 413Andrey Andreev1-4/+25
2012-01-05Numerous improvements to the Oracle (oci8) driver and DB_driverAndrey Andreev4-141/+646
2012-01-02Updating copyright date to 2012Greg Aker4-4/+4
2011-12-25Fixing soft tabs in a few files.Greg Aker1-5/+4
2011-11-23fix to issue #696 - make oci_execute calls inside num_rows non-committing, ↵a-krebs1-2/+2
since they are only there to reset which row is next in line for oci_fetch calls and thus don't need to be committed.
2011-10-22Merge pull request #553 from narfbg/ci-oci8-driver-php5Phil Sturgeon2-126/+95
Cleanup and switch oci8_driver and oci8_result to PHP5 functions.
2011-10-20adding new license file (OSL 3.0) and updating readme to ReSTDerek Jones4-16/+64
added notice of license to all source files. OSL to all except the few files we ship inside of the application folder, those are AFL. Updated license in user guide. incrementing next dev version to 3.0 due to licensing change
2011-10-20Some public and protected method declarationsAndrey Andreev2-36/+36
2011-10-07Remove another 2 old commentsAndrey Andreev1-2/+0
2011-10-07Cleanup and migrate oci8_driver and oci8_result from deprecated PHP4 to PHP5 ↵Andrey Andreev2-115/+86
style functions
2011-09-23Merge pull request #469 from narfbg/ci-issue-182Greg Aker1-7/+10
Fix issue #182: OCI8's num_rows() re-executing the statement
2011-09-23Add brackets to the for() loopAndrey Andreev1-0/+2
2011-09-23Add ->db->insert_batch() support to the OCI8 (Oracle) driverAndrey Andreev1-1/+27
2011-09-21Fix issue #182 in system/database/drivers/oci8_result.php by caching the ↵Andrey Andreev1-7/+10
num_rows property after statement execution
2011-09-17Fix ./system/database/drivers/oci8_driver.php to pass the configured ↵narfbg1-3/+3
database character set on connect.
2011-08-25oci8 driver escape string quotes fixMichiel Vugteveen1-0/+1
2011-08-20Fixed a bug (#200) where MySQL queries would be malformed after calling ↵Greg Aker1-0/+1
db->count_all() then db->get()
2011-07-02backed out 648b42a75739, which was a NON-trivial whitespace commit. It ↵Derek Jones4-89/+89
broke the Typography class's string replacements, for instance